10 Excel Hacks That Will Save Time & Impress Your Boss


1. Flash Fill (Ctrl + E)

Excel auto-completes patterns.

Example: Write full names from first and last name columns.

How to Use: Type the first pattern, then press Ctrl + E.


2. Remove Duplicates in Seconds

Go to: DataRemove Duplicates
Perfect for cleaning up emails, entries, or IDs in bulk.


3. Conditional Formatting for Instant Insights

Highlight important trends visually.

Example: Mark cells red if value < 1000.

Go to: HomeConditional Formatting


4. Use VLOOKUP Like a Pro

Match data across sheets without wasting time.
Formula: =VLOOKUP(lookup_value, table_array, col_index, FALSE)

Pro Tip: Replace with XLOOKUP in Office 365 – easier and smarter.


5. Quick Analysis Tool (Ctrl + Q)

Highlight your data → Press Ctrl + Q → Get charts, totals, trends in 1 click.


6. Create Drop-Down Lists

Makes your sheet interactive and organized.

Go to: DataData Validation → Choose “List”


7. Freeze Panes for Easy Navigation

Pin headers when scrolling long sheets.

ViewFreeze PanesFreeze Top Row or Freeze First Column


8. Pivot Tables in 2 Minutes

Summarize 1000s of rows with drag-and-drop.

Go to InsertPivot Table

Use to find total sales by month, customer, or product instantly.


9. Custom Sort with Colors or Icons

Highlight urgent or important rows with color-based sorting.
Go to: Sort & FilterCustom Sort


10. Use TEXT Functions for Clean Reports

Clean up messy data using:

  • =TRIM() – removes extra spaces
  • =PROPER() – capitalizes each word
  • =CONCATENATE() or =TEXTJOIN() – combines text neatly
